Output f22cbb86a8b818f5b9dc7df10b43cc2f3f86a058346dae85de48cc9d0304e9dd:3

value
22368735776
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d3acf01896457192aa072c66f3b0c7815b27256 OP_EQUALVERIFY OP_CHECKSIG
address
1589rj9hw8Nf27quJbSrqhbCXbBC5LhSmN
transaction
f22cbb86a8b818f5b9dc7df10b43cc2f3f86a058346dae85de48cc9d0304e9dd
confirmations
487219
spent
true